cách phân biệt real, byte, integer phân biệt char và string dễ hiểu nhât
2 câu trả lời
phân biệt real, byte, integer
byte: số tự nhiên nhưng có gái trị rất nhỏ (0-255)
real: số thập phân, có giá trị cả âm và dương
integer: có số âm và số dương
cách này theo mik dễ phân biệt nhất là
+khi bạn thấy giá trị rất nhỏ. kiểu 1 cụ kẹo thì dùng byte
+còn khi giá trị là số thập phânthì dùng real. nó có giá trị lớn
+còn khi mà giá trị là số tự nhiên mà có giá trị lướn thì dùng integer
char, string
char: khi khai báo sẽ có dạng <tên biến>:= " "(nóic hung có dấu nháy
string thì ko có
xin hay nhất
cách phân biệt theo cách của mình là
-Dùng real khi đề yêu cầu số thực
→Vd: nhập số thực k, tính.....
var k : real;
-Dùng byte khi đề yêu cầu số tự nhiên trong khoảng 0 đến 255
→Vd : nhập 1số tự nhiên g với g≤255
var g:byte;
-Char được dùng khi đề yêu cầu nhập 1 ký tự
→Vd: nhập 1 ký tự vào biến a
var a:char;
-Dùng string khi đề yêu cầu nhập 2 ký tự trở lên (thường gọi là xâu ký tự)
→nhập xâu ký tự vào biến lyna
var lyna:string(x);
→x nếu bỏ trống thì mặc định là 255 ký tự, nếu bạn nhập x, thì có nghĩa là số ký tự trong xâu lyna được giới hạn tới x
`khoadang09`